Neck and back injuries are some of the most common injuries seen by the attorneys at O’Brien Boyd. Perhaps you have had few problems (if any) with your back or neck before the date of the accident. However, once the accident occurs, you find within just a few days that you cannot get a good night’s sleep, go to work or perform many of the day-to-day activities that you could do before the accident.

Getting rear-ended in a car accident – even if you are wearing a seat belt – is just one cause of neck and back injuries. These injuries can result in:

  • Ruptured, bulging, protruding or herniated intervertebral discs in the cervical, thoracic or lumbar spine
  • Compression fractures of the vertebrae of the spine
  • The accumulation of fluid in a growth in the spinal canal (known as a syrinx)
  • Whiplash or other type of acceleration/deceleration injury
  • A sprained ligament
  • A strained muscle or tendon
  • Intense pain
  • Fever
  • Radiculopathy (irritated nerves that can cause pain, numbness, tingling and weakness)
  • Skull and pelvis fractures
